Parent Company of YouTube
YouTube is owned by Alphabet Inc., a multinational conglomerate that was created in 2015 as a restructuring of Google. Alphabet Inc. is a publicly traded company listed on the NASDAQ stock exchange under the ticker symbols GOOGL and GOOG.
Does YouTube Have Stocks?
No, YouTube itself does not have stocks. However, by investing in Alphabet Inc., you can gain exposure to YouTube's financial performance. As a subsidiary of Alphabet Inc., YouTube's revenue and profits are consolidated into the parent company's financial statements.
Investment Opportunities
- Alphabet Inc. (GOOGL, GOOG) - You can buy stocks of Alphabet Inc., which gives you exposure to YouTube's financial performance.
- Index Funds and ETFs - You can also invest in index funds and ETFs that track the performance of the NASDAQ-100 index or the S&P 500 index, which includes Alphabet Inc.
